"No tests found for given includes" - Tests mit Gradle in IntelliJ

21. Februar 2020 Softwaretest von Eric Kubenka

Beim Ausführen oder Debuggen von einzelnen Tests komplexer Testsuiten mit Gradle in IntelliJ habe ich des Öfteren von Kollegen schon folgenden Fehler erhalten - Mit der einfachen Bitte, dies doch zu Beheben.

Caused by: org.gradle.api.GradleException: No tests found for given includes: [com.example........XyzTestclassTest]

Das Ganze ist jedoch kein globaler Fehler in den vorhanden Testsuiten oder Testfällen, sondern schlichtweg eine Konfigurationseinstellung im IntelliJ.

Der Fehler lässt sich durch das Anpassen folgender Einstellung im IntelliJ beheben.

Navigiert über das Menu zu folgendem Eintrag

File > Settings > Build, Execution, Deployment > Build Tools > Gradle

Dort angekommen ändert die Einsetllung von Run tests using: auf den Wert IntelliJ IDEA

Danach solltet ihr bei dem Ausführen von einzelnen Testfäällen über das Kontextmenu (zu erreichen mit Rechtsklick) den oben gezeigten Fehler nicht mehr erhalten.

Zurück

Einen Kommentar schreiben

Kommentar von Andreas |

Einfach weil mir diese kleine aber feine Seite ziemlich viel Arbeit gespart hat, sage ich Dankeschön an den Ersteller :)

Kommentar von GK |

Danke für die Info, hat leider aber nicht geholfen bei mir. Krieg weiterhin den selben Fehler.

Kommentar von x |

Die Option gibt es bei A.S. leider nicht mehr.

Bitte rechnen Sie 8 plus 3.